There are tons of little tips and tricks you can use to make your outfit look good. But the easiest move by far is the half-tuck. You know, folding your top halfway into a skirt or jeans and letting the rest, sort of, hang out. If you look at street style photos from any season, you'll realize this is every fashion girl's go-to styling move. The half-tuck has been around forever because it's an easy way to give your outfit a more dynamic feel. Plus, you can do it with virtually any kind of shirt. (Our favorite is with a button-down.)

Fully tuck a button-down into your pantsuit at work for a polished look. As soon as that clock strikes 5pm, however, do the half-tuck for a more casual feel.

The half-tuck is useful when you want to show off the designs on your skirt or pants, which would otherwise be covered by your top.

You can pull off the half-tuck with any type of bottom – even shorts. This street-style star added more dimension to her look by folding in part of her top.

Take your half-tucked look one step further by layering on another piece, like a sweater.

The next time you're borrowing a flannel or button-down from your SO's closet and it's too big, use the half-tuck to make it look more fitted.

An easy way to give the half-tuck a try is with jeans.

You don't need an oversize shirt to pull off the half-tuck. It works with shorter hemline tops too.

The half-tuck is great when you're wearing a monochrome outfit that needs that extra something-something.

Do the half-tuck when you want to show off a cool belt.

The classic way to pull off the half-tuck style is with a white button-down.
